Understanding Balinese Fine Art

Bali, the home of the famous island paradise of Indonesia, is renowned for its beautiful and vibrant culture. Its art is no exception. Balinese fine art is a unique and fascinating form of expression that has developed over centuries and is still highly appreciated today.

Balinese fine art is an incredibly diverse form of visual expression, ranging from painted murals to intricate wood carvings. The most popular and recognizable works are often the intricate and colorful temple reliefs, which depict scenes from Hindu mythology. These works often feature detailed and lifelike figures, many times with a spiritual or mythical element.


The Balinese culture has been heavily influenced by Hinduism as well as Chinese trade and culture, and this is reflected in the artwork. There is a strong focus on spiritual and mythical themes, and the works often feature deities and religious figures. Many of the works are also inspired by Buddhism, with its themes of peace and compassion.


The Balinese art is also known for its use of vibrant colors and intricate designs. Many of the works feature a combination of bright colors, intricate patterns, and detailed figures. These works are often created with natural materials, including wood, stone, and clay.


Due to the strong influence of Hinduism and Buddhism, many of the works also feature a strong spiritual element balinese fine art. The works often depict scenes from Hindu mythology and Buddhist teachings, and some of the most famous pieces feature Hindu gods and goddesses.


Balinese art is often used to decorate temples, and the works often feature a combination of religious and cultural elements. The works are often designed to honor and celebrate the gods, and to remind people of the importance of faith and spirituality.


One of the most interesting aspects of Balinese art is the way in which it can be used to tell stories. Many of the works feature figures and scenes from Hindu mythology, which are often used to explain aspects of the culture or to convey a message.
